Step 1: Create a Clear Conference Page
Every conference should start with a strong event page. This page should answer the most important questions before attendees contact the organizer.
A good conference page should include:
- conference title;
- theme or purpose;
- date and time;
- venue and city;
- speaker or panel information;
- agenda highlights;
- ticket or registration categories;
- payment instructions;
- organizer contact;
- refund or transfer policy where relevant.

Step 2: Set Up Conference Registration
A strong online conference registration Ghana process should collect the right information without overwhelming attendees.
Useful conference registration fields may include:
- full name;
- phone number;
- email address;
- organization;
- job title or school;
- ticket category;
- dietary needs where relevant;
- accessibility needs where relevant;
- consent to receive event updates.
Do not collect unnecessary information. Ghana’s Data Protection Commission states that it enforces the Data Protection Act, 2012 (Act 843), which regulates the processing of personal information. Source: Data Protection Commission Ghana
The Commission also states that organizations that collect or process personal data in Ghana are required to register with it. Source: Data Protection Commission Registration
For conference organizers, responsible data collection is not only good practice. It is part of building trust.

Step 5: Communicate Before the Conference
Good conferences communicate early. Guests should not have to guess what to bring, where to go, or when to arrive.
Before the event, organizers should send:
- registration confirmations;
- venue directions;
- parking or transport notes;
- agenda reminders;
- speaker updates;
- check-in instructions;
- dress code or access notes;
- last-minute changes.
Clear communication improves attendance and reduces support pressure on the organizer.
Step 6: Make Check-In Fast and Professional
The check-in desk sets the tone for the conference. If attendees wait too long, the event feels disorganized before the first session begins.
A good conference check-in Ghana setup should include:
- trained registration staff;
- a clear entry point;
- separate lines for speakers, VIPs, or general attendees where needed;
- QR code or digital ticket checking;
- a help desk for registration issues;
- badges or access tags where necessary.
QR code conference check-in helps organizers confirm attendees faster and reduce manual list errors.

Step 8: Track Results After the Conference
A conference does not end when the final speaker leaves the stage. Organizers should review the data and learn from it.
Track:
- total registrations;
- total ticket sales;
- ticket categories sold;
- check-in rate;
- no-show rate;
- peak arrival time;
- refund or support issues;
- attendee feedback;
- interest in future events.
This data helps organizers improve future conferences, choose better venues, adjust prices, improve communication, and plan stronger programs.
